Not to 11.5, but I know 10->11 can go fine via standard OS admin, I’ve
personally done it. I’d be surprised if it was different to 11.5
Worst comes to worst, you could do the incremental to 10.5, and then do OS
admin to go 10.5->11.5 (or 10->11, then the incremental from 11->11.5)

Subject: [cisco-voip] CUCM Upgrade 10.0 to 11.5 only via PCD?
Hello all,
Looking at the upgrade docs for 11.5 @
http://www.cisco.com/c/en/us/td/docs/voice_ip_comm/cucm/upgrade/11_5_1/cucm_b_upgrade-guide-cucm-115/cucm_b_upgrade-guide-cucm-115_chapter_01100.html
It states that upgrades from 10.0.x to 11.5 are only supported via PCD upgrade.
Has anyone already done this via standard OS Admin?
As I'm not migrating, I don't see any major advantages on using PCD.
